Village of Park Forest Park Permit Lottery Begins on February 6

Park Forest, IL–(ENEWSPF)–January 30, 2016.   The Park Forest Recreation and Parks Department will hold its Annual Parks Pavilion Permit Lottery on Saturday, February 6, beginning at 9 a.m. at Park Forest’s Village Hall, 350 Victory Drive. The event is held each year to allow members of the public the opportunity to secure their preferred Park Forest park pavilion on their preferred date.

New in 2016, two separate lotteries will be held for Park Forest residents and non-Park Forest residents. This new system is designed to allow Park Forest residents priority selection in what has become a popular lottery event, with an increasing number of non-Park Forest residents participating in the process. The Park Permit Lottery for Park Forest residents will begin at 9 a.m. The lottery for non-Park Forest residents will immediately follow the Park Forest resident lottery.

All members of the public (Park Forest residents and non-Park Forest residents) must be present by 9 a.m. Please arrive between 8:30 and 8:45 a.m. Those in attendance by 9 a.m. will be invited to place their names in the appropriate permit lottery. Please bring a State ID to verify residency. Names will be pulled for the Park Forest resident permit lottery first, and permits will be issued in the order names are selected. Names will be drawn for the non-Park Forest resident lottery second, and permits will be issued in the order names are selected. Please note that individuals are restricted to one picnic date per person. Full payment is due at time of reserving a permit.
